Message type: E = Error
Message class: HRPAYDE_ETG - German Pay Transparency Act
Message number: 009
Message text: Personnel number of the requester does not exist.

HRPAYDE_ETG009
- Personnel number of the requester does not exist. ?The SAP error message HRPAYDE_ETG009 indicates that the personnel number of the requester does not exist in the system. This error typically occurs in the context of HR processes, such as payroll or employee data management, where the system is trying to validate the personnel number associated with the user making the request.
Causes:
- Incorrect Personnel Number: The personnel number entered by the user may be incorrect or mistyped.
- User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to access the personnel number in question.
- Personnel Number Not Created: The personnel number may not have been created in the system, possibly due to data entry errors or incomplete processes.
- Data Deletion: The personnel number may have been deleted or archived, making it unavailable for current transactions.
- System Configuration Issues: There may be configuration issues in the HR module that prevent the system from recognizing the personnel number.
Solutions:
- Verify Personnel Number: Check the personnel number entered by the requester for accuracy. Ensure that it matches the format and exists in the system.
- Check User Authorizations: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ations to access the personnel number. This may involve checking roles and permissions in the SAP system.
- Create or Reactivate Personnel Number: If the personnel number does not exist, it may need to be created or reactivated by an HR administrator.
- Consult HR Master Data: Use transaction codes like PA20 (Display HR Master Data) or PA30 (Maintain HR Master Data) to check if the personnel number exists and is active.
- Review System Logs: Check system logs for any additional error messages or warnings that may provide more context about the issue.
-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ists and cannot be resolved through the above steps, consider reaching out to SAP support for further assistance.
